Publisher's Synopsis

The Phi Kappa Sigma Quarterly is a book that was published between the months of February 1891 and April 1898. It is a publication that is devoted to the interests of the Phi Kappa Sigma Fraternity. The book was written by George Gordon Battle and contains a complete description of the fraternity, including its history, values, and goals. It also includes articles on various topics related to the fraternity, such as its members, events, and activities.
